What Is Jaundice?
Jaundice develops when bilirubin, a yellow pigment produced during the normal breakdown of red blood cells, builds up in the bloodstream.
Normally, the liver processes bilirubin and excretes it through bile. When this process is disrupted, bilirubin accumulates, causing yellowing of the skin and eyes.

What Causes Jaundice?
Jaundice may result from problems occurring before the liver, within the liver, or after the liver.
Liver-Related Causes
-
Viral Hepatitis (A, B, C, E)
-
Fatty Liver Disease (MASLD)
-
Alcohol-related Liver Disease
-
Liver Cirrhosis
-
Drug-induced Liver Injury
-
Autoimmune Liver Disease
Gallbladder & Bile Duct Causes
-
Gallbladder Stones
-
Common Bile Duct (CBD) Stones
-
Bile Duct Strictures
-
Cholangitis
-
Bile Duct Tumors
Pancreatic Causes
-
Acute Pancreatitis
-
Chronic Pancreatitis
-
Pancreatic Tumors
-
Pancreatic Head Cancer causing bile duct obstruction
Blood-Related Causes
-
Hemolytic anemia
-
Certain inherited blood disorders
-
Reactions to incompatible blood transfusion
Types of Jaundice
Hepatocellular Jaundice
Caused by diseases affecting liver cells, such as hepatitis or cirrhosis.
Obstructive Jaundice
Occurs when bile flow is blocked, commonly due to gallstones, bile duct narrowing, or pancreatic disease.
Hemolytic Jaundice
Results from excessive breakdown of red blood cells.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is jaundice contagious?
Jaundice itself is not contagious. However, some causes, such as viral hepatitis A and E, can spread through contaminated food and water, while hepatitis B and C spread through blood or body fluids.
Can jaundice go away on its own?
Some mild conditions resolve with treatment or supportive care, but jaundice should always be evaluated because it may indicate serious liver or biliary disease.
Which doctor should I consult for jaundice?
Adults with jaundice should be evaluated by a Gastroenterologist and Liver Specialist (Hepatologist) to determine the underlying cause and appropriate treatment.
Is jaundice always caused by liver disease?
No. Jaundice may also result from blood disorders, gallbladder disease, bile duct obstruction, or pancreatic conditions.
